Title:
  Can't move windows by dragging title bar; can't resize windows

Status in gnome-shell package in Ubuntu:
  New

Bug description:
  After a recent update in 21.04, I can no longer move windows with
  integrated title bars (eg nautilus, firefox, gnome-terminal) by
  clicking on the taskbar and dragging. I can't resize them either -
  although the mouse icon changes, when I click and move the mouse the
  window doesn't resize.

  I can move a window holding the Super key and clicking near the
  window, but it's a bit hit-and-miss - sometimes it moves a different
  window.

  Windows without an integrated titlebar seem to be fine (eg
  thunderbird, synaptic).
